Learn key facts about Certificate in Project Management Information Systems
- The Certificate in Project Management Information Systems equips students with the skills to effectively manage projects using information systems.
- Students will learn how to integrate technology into project management processes to improve efficiency and productivity.
- The program focuses on developing competencies in areas such as project planning, scheduling, budgeting, and risk management.
- Upon completion, students will be able to apply project management principles in various industries, including IT, healthcare, finance, and construction.
- The curriculum covers topics like project management software, data analysis, information security, and communication strategies.
- This certificate program offers a practical and hands-on approach to learning, allowing students to gain real-world experience in managing projects using information systems.
- Graduates will have a competitive edge in the job market, with skills that are in high demand across industries.
- The Certificate in Project Management Information Systems is designed for individuals looking to advance their careers in project management or transition into the field from related disciplines.
